Subject: DR drill Thursday — digest scheduler

Team,

Thursday's disaster-recovery drill will fail over the Mistral batch email digest scheduler to the Kelworth standby cluster. Digests pause for ~20 minutes; no customer action needed. New folks: you'll re-auth the scheduler service account during failover. The recovery prompt accepts only the passphrase below.

unlock words, yawig-kagef: gordor-holvan-ulaael-pramir-ulaiel-tamdor

## Runbook: Veldora session-token refresh bug

If users report sudden logouts, the refresh worker has likely stalled and tokens are expiring before renewal. First confirm the worker heartbeat is stale, then restart it and verify new tokens are issued within two minutes. Before restarting, carefully compare the live settings against the expected values shown below.

deployment values, bahof-badug:
[rusix]
team = zorok
access_code = ac_641cbe
owner = ulair.tamius
host = rusix.torvasoft.local
port = 5672
peer = ulaix.sivrelworks.internal
salt = 1df570ed
pin = 6327

## Authentication

StageGrid, the seat-map renderer for the Orpheum Vale theatre group, requires a key for the internal layout service before any render jobs run. The key is scoped to the render cluster only and does not grant access to booking data. Release managers should confirm the key is present in the deployment manifest before tagging a build, as missing credentials cause silent fallbacks to the cached map. For the current release, use the key below.

API key for kajog-tajep: zpat11_KM2XGfcA8zM